Hi all!

I've been trying to connect the Handycam to my laptop through USB and
I'm getting no success...
The device is detected:

- ----syslog----
May  4 09:31:15 tash kernel: usb 1-1: new full speed USB device using
address 4
(no further lines)
- ----syslog----

but it isn't detected as an usb-storage.

- ----lsusb -vv----
Bus 001 Device 004: ID 054c:002e Sony Corp. Sony HandyCam MemoryStick Reader
